Texans (10-5) at Chargers (11-4)

Kickoff: 4:30 PM • NFL Network
Spread: LAC -1.5
Total: 40.5

The Texans have won seven in a row and the Chargers have won four in a row. The Chargers have managed to not only survive, but flourish since Justin Herbert suffered a fracture in his left hand – beating Dallas, Kansas City, and Philadelphia. Houston has won three out of the last four matchups.

Final Score Prediction: Texans 23, Chargers 20. Take the TEXANS and the OVER.


Ravens (7-8) at Packers (9-5-1)

Kickoff: 8:00 PM • Peacock
Spread: GB -2.5
Total: 38.5

This is going to be a battle of backup quarterbacks. The Ravens need to win the division to make the playoffs – a wildcard spot is not an option. They need to win their last two and hope the Steelers lose one of their last two.

Final Score Prediction: Ravens 17, Packers 16. Take the RAVENS and the UNDER.

Bears (11-4) at 49ers (11-4)

Kickoff: 8:20 PM • NBC/Peacock
Spread: SF -3
Total: 52.5

The 49ers are hitting on all cylinders at just the right time. Super Bowl champions are not won by teams that had the better regular seasons, but by teams who get hot at the end of the season. This should be a high-scoring affair.

Final Score Prediction: 49ers 34, Bears 30. Take the 49ers and the OVER.
